Examples of Work

  • Enforce local, state, and federal laws to protect life and property
  • Patrol assigned areas to deter crime and ensure public safety
  • Respond to emergency and non-emergency calls for service
  • Investigate crimes by collecting evidence and interviewing victims and witnesses
  • Prepare accurate reports and maintain detailed records
  • Make arrests and issue citations when appropriate
  • Enforce traffic laws and respond to traffic accidents
  • Provide assistance and support to individuals in crisis situations
  • Engage with the community to build trust and promote crime prevention
  • Testify in court and work with prosecutors and other justice partners
  • Uphold departmental policies, ethical standards, and professional conduct

Qualifications

  • U.S. Citizen
  • High School graduate; (60+ college credit hours preferred)
  • 21 years old at time of graduation from the Police Academy (20 years and 3 months old at time of application)
  • Possess a valid drivers license and at least 6 months driving experience
  • Successfully complete all requirements of the Background and Selection Process

To be considered for employment, Applicants must successfully complete all of the following steps:

  • Submit an online application
  • Preliminary Application and Applicant History Review
  • Register with the National Testing Network to complete the Written Exam www.nationaltestingnetwork.com
  • Download and complete the participation waiver
  • Self-schedule (online) and pass the APRT.
  • Preliminary Documents and Records Check

If sufficient vacancies exist, applicants at this stage may be contacted to continue into the Background Investigation process, which includes:

  • Download, complete, and submit the Personal History Statement (PHS)
  • Initial Interview
  • Background Investigation
  • Oral Board
  • Polygraph Examination
  • Psychological Screening
  • Medical Examination & Drug Screening Test
  • Hiring Consideration
  • Final Offer of Employment
  • Graduation from the Prince Georges County Police Academy

General Plan Information:

The Prince George's County benefits plan year is from January 1 to December 31.

A spouse (to include a same sex spouse) can be added to the health benefit plans. A marriage certificate and social security number is required to add a spouse.

Children under the age of 26 are eligible for coverage under the health benefit plans. This includes stepchildren and children of the same-sex spouse. A birth certificate(s) and social security number(s) is required to add a child(ren). If you are only adding the stepchildren or child(ren) of a same-sex spouse, you will need to submit a marriage certificate. You will also need to submit the birth certificate of the child(ren) and your spouse must be listed as a parent.

The premiums for health benefits are deducted on a pre-tax basis with the exception of Long-Term Disability, Extra Life Insurance and Voluntary Benefits (Short-Term Disability, Whole Life Insurance, Critical Illness, Accident Insurance, Cancer Indemnity, Hospital Indemnity Protection, Accident Indemnity Plan, Supplemental Dental and Group Legal Services).

New employees must enroll in the County's health benefit plans within thirty (30) days of the hire date.

The effective date of the health benefits coverage is the beginning of the month following a waiting period of forty-five (45) days from the date of hire.

After enrolling in the County's benefit plans, employees may only make changes to the plans either during the open enrollment period, which occurs annually (usually each October), and/or during the year, due to a family status change (i.e., marriage, births, divorce and adoption).
